Transaction 291b966936cd9345e82491226db8e28379838349f9a72987db74397d9d440095

1 Input
2 Outputs
  • 291b966936cd9345e82491226db8e28379838349f9a72987db74397d9d440095:0
  • value  507067
    address  1EG1pdkFFUi3E6DPmXvotE79RfEEqyzRSR
  • 291b966936cd9345e82491226db8e28379838349f9a72987db74397d9d440095:1
  • value  5000000
    address  16KeYsBi3qKsLnYvttCxfVH59QNXvpEdvQ